State Patrol Trooper/Inspector

 Helpful info | Video

Join the team of State Patrol Troopers and Inspectors who are dedicated to promoting highway safety and enhancing the quality of life for all Wisconsin citizens and visitors by providing professional, competent and compassionate law enforcement services.

The Wisconsin State Patrol has completed their 2008 recruitment.  The next projected date for recruitment is spring of 2009.  Successful candidates will undergo 21 weeks of basic program training at the State Patrol Academy in Fort McCoy, Wisconsin. Upon successful completion, applicants will be classified as either a Sate Patrol Trooper or Inspector.  You will be required to serve a two-year probationary period.

The trooper/inspector exam is a multiple choice exam that contains observation and recall; basic mathematics; analytical skills including reasoning and problem solving; interpersonal responsiveness and reliability, oral and written communications, effective work habits; ability to read and interpret complex written materials such as laws, policies and procedures.
